Question
Evaluate the following :
`|(1 , 1),(2 , 3)| |(2 , 1),(1 , 4)|`
Advertisements
Solution
`|(1 , 1),(2 , 3)|_(2 xx 2) |(2 , 1),(1 , 4)|_(2 xx 2)`
`= |(2 + 1 , 1 + 4),(4 + 3 , 2 + 12)|`
`= |(3 , 5),(7 , 14)|_(2 xx 2)`
